Currently Chelsea F are in poll position with Norwich narrowly behind. This years new challengers SWCP sit in 3rd position.
Winners of the National League become the finalists at the FA Disability Cup 2026 and compete at St George’s Park.

4 weeks ago in the @FA Disability Cup Final 2025 @cpnwfootball won 4-2 against @CFCFoundation after going down 1-0 initially! They came back again from 2-1 down to win the game with quick consecutive goals taking chelsea by surprise!
